Você está na página 1de 4

Acadêmico: Carlos Alberto de Souza R.A.

21138041-5

Curso: Engenharia de produção

Disciplina: Programação e Cálculo Numérico

Você é engenheiro em uma empresa que possui um tanque de armazenamento


esférico, contendo óleo, conforme ilustrado a seguir. Esse tanque tem um diâmetro de 6
ft. Você deve determinar a altura, h, até a qual uma vareta de 8 ft de comprimento ficaria
molhada com óleo quando imersa no tanque, quando esse contém 4 ft de óleo.

Fonte: o autor.

A equação que fornece a altura, h, do líquido no tanque esférico para determinado


volume e raio é dada

por:

𝑓(ℎ) = ℎ − 9ℎ + 3,8197 = 0
Use o método da bissecção para encontrar raízes de equações para encontrar a
altura, h, que representa a altura em que essa vareta está molhada com óleo. Conduza três
iterações para estimar a raiz da equação anterior.

Dica: pela física do problema, a vareta estaria molhada entre o intervalo de ℎ = 0 𝑒 ℎ =


𝑑𝑖â𝑚𝑒𝑡𝑟𝑜.
Equação dada:

𝑓(ℎ) = ℎ − 9ℎ + 3,8197
Aplicando o método da bisseção para o intervalo de [0,6], portanto, 𝑎 = 0 𝑒 𝑏 = 6:

𝑎 +𝑏
𝑥 =
2
0+6
𝑥 = =3
2

Substituindo na equação:

𝑓(𝑎 ) = ℎ − 9ℎ + 3,8197
𝑓(0) = 0 − 9 ∙ 0 + 3,8197
𝑓(0) = 3,1897
𝑓(𝑥 ) = ℎ − 9ℎ + 3,8197
𝑓(3) = 3 − 9 ∙ 3 + 3,8197
𝑓(3) = 27 − 9 ∙ 9 + 3,8197
𝑓(3) = −50,1803

Multiplicando as substituições:

𝑓(𝑎 ) ∙ 𝑓(𝑥 ) = 3,8197 ∙ (−50,1803) = −191,6740

Como o resultado da multiplicação é negativo, o 𝑏 assume o valor do 𝑥 calculado.


Aplicando o método da bisseção para o intervalo de [0; 3]:

0+3
𝑥 = = 1,5
2

𝑓(𝑎 ) = ℎ − 9ℎ + 3,8197

𝑓(0) = 0 − 9 ∙ 0 + 3,8197
𝑓(0) = 3,1897
𝑓(𝑥 ) = ℎ − 9ℎ + 3,8197
𝑓(1,5) = 1,5 − 9 ∙ 1,5 + 3,8197
𝑓(1,5) = 3,375 − 20,25 + 3,8197
𝑓(1,5) = −13,0553

𝑓(𝑎 ) ∙ 𝑓(𝑥 ) = 3,8197 ∙ (−13,0553) = −49,8673

Considerando o erro dado na aula ao vivo (1):

𝑥 −𝑥 1,5 − 3
𝐸𝑟𝑟𝑜 = = =1
𝑥 1,5

Novamente o 𝑏 recebe o valor do 𝑥 calculado.


Intervalo de [0; 1,5]:
𝑎 +𝑏
𝑥 =
2
0 + 1,5
𝑥 = = 0,75
2

𝑓(𝑎 ) = ℎ − 9ℎ + 3,8197

𝑓(0) = 0 − 9 ∙ 0 + 3,8197
𝑓(0) = 3,1897
𝑓(𝑥 ) = ℎ − 9ℎ + 3,8197
𝑓(0,75) = 0,75 − 9 ∙ 0,75 + 3,8197
𝑓(0,75) = 0,4219 − 5,0625 + 3,8197
𝑓(0,75) = −0,8209

𝑓(𝑎 ) ∙ 𝑓(𝑥 ) = 3,8197 ∙ (−0,8209) = −3,1356

0,75 − 1,5
𝐸𝑟𝑟𝑜 = =1
0,75
Intervalo [0;0,75]:
𝑎 +𝑏
𝑥 =
2
0 + 0,75
𝑥 = = 0,375
2

𝑓(𝑎 ) = ℎ − 9ℎ + 3,8197

𝑓(0) = 0 − 9 ∙ 0 + 3,8197
𝑓(0) = 3,1897
𝑓(𝑥 ) = ℎ − 9ℎ + 3,8197
𝑓(0,375) = 0,375 − 9 ∙ 0,375 + 3,8197
𝑓(0,375) = 2,6068

𝑓(𝑎 ) ∙ 𝑓(𝑥 ) = 3,8197 ∙ 2,6068 = 9,9572

0,375 − 0,75
𝐸𝑟𝑟𝑜 = =1
0,375

Realizando os cálculos no Excel para conferência:

i a b xi=(a+b)/2 erro.abs f(a) f(xi) f(a)*f(xi)


0 0 6 3 3,8197 -50,18 -191,67
1 0 3 1,5 1 3,8197 -13,055 -49,867
2 0 1,5 0,75 1 3,8197 -0,8209 -3,1357
3 0 0,75 0,375 1 3,8197 2,60681 9,95723

Portanto, 𝑥 = ℎ = 0,375 ± 1.

Você também pode gostar